French-Born African Defender Becomes Chelsea Longest Contracted Player, Loaned To Stoke
Published: July 21, 2017
Chelsea have announced that French-born Central African Republic defender Kurt Zouma has extended his contract with the Premier League champions.
Zouma has penned a six-year contract that will keep him at Stamford Bridge until June 30, 2023, subject to the approval of Fifa.
The center back, who is now Chelsea's longest contracted player, has been farmed out on loan to Stoke City for the entirety of the 2017-18 season.
The 22-year-old has 71 appearances under his belt for Chelsea since he broke into the first team in 2014, and played nine games in the Premier League last season and it would have been more if not for injury.
Chelsea signed Kurt Zouma from French club Saint-étienne three-and-a-half years ago.
